Problem Statement

Girls on the Run of the Bay Area need a cohesive and efficient redesign of graphic communication systems for distribution.
Purpose Statement
The purpose of this study is to develop an appropriate and efficient promotional campaign to increase visibility and credibility of Girls on the Run of the Bay Area.

Sub Problems
1. Analyze strategic methods used for marketing to women and girls.
2. Discover what current methods are employed to create effective public relations and marketing communication programs that connect the female client to brands.
3. Analyze what methods are used on brand positioning in marketing collateral.
4. Analyze the existing communication graphics and marketing services for Girls on the Run of the Bay Area.
5. Analyze the various marketing services and communication programs used in the industry.
6. Discover the theme and style guide for Girls on the Run of the Bay Area.

Hypothesis/Solutions
1) A specialized designed marketing communication system will create a unique way to maintain brand and integrity intact.

1.
The creation of a style guide and procedures/guidelines for designing and packaging the communication graphics will expand the brand reach for Girls on the Run of the Bay Area.
2. The redesign and reconfiguration of the existing style guide will facilitate and improve programs at GOTR.
3. The design of a flexible template system and communication style guide will facilitate the ability of GOTR to modify their campaigns for future programs.
